6 FAQs about [What does energy storage in switchgear mean ]

What is the purpose of switchgear in an electrical system?

The purpose of switchgear in an electrical system is to protect electrical equipment from damage due to overloads, short circuits, or other electrical faults. It does this by interrupting the flow of electrical current when abnormal conditions are detected.

What is the difference between switchgear and switchboard?

Switchgear typically refers to the combination of electrical disconnect switches, fuses, or circuit breakers used to control, protect, and isolate electrical equipment, while switchboards are specifically panels containing switches and other controls for distributing electricity within a building or facility. 1. How do switchgear and substation power systems work together?

Switchgear and substation power systems work together to deliver electric power and mitigate potential electrical faults downstream in the electrical generation process ensuring safe electrical power.

What is a switchgear panel?

A section of a large switchgear panel. This circuit breaker uses both SF 6 and air as insulation. In an electric power system, a switchgear is composed of electrical disconnect switches, fuses or circuit breakers used to control, protect and isolate electrical equipment.

What is a switchgear in a PV power plant?

It is critical to provide various switchgears on the DC and AC side of the PV power plant for protection and isolation purposes while complying with grid connection standards. Switchgear is the combination of electrical disconnect switches, fuse, or circuit breaker used to control, protect and isolate the electrical equipment.
